Transaction 1657cb418886ba251404269c97496154525d7da319c33722f02f83e6e30c4441
1 Input
1 Output
-
1657cb418886ba251404269c97496154525d7da319c33722f02f83e6e30c4441:0
- value
- 801692
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 20feee343bf46fd61268fc448a8866eebfd50093 OP_EQUAL
- address
- 34hUwZbv7wXLKfqezEDqtr6zSUPerwJCBZ